Output 30ae8408eab7157b291840cf4d225c2a3a43aafb17d17078dfbf08cdd2e14d7f:1

value
21008774
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58c6d942e4ff15bc66f698e2a4851d60b99fd57e OP_EQUALVERIFY OP_CHECKSIG
address
196Qg8WCMjVanAUzS4krGdamPfRRjznVhh
transaction
30ae8408eab7157b291840cf4d225c2a3a43aafb17d17078dfbf08cdd2e14d7f
spent
true